2. Key Features of the "Archipelago" Concept

  • The End of the Monoculture: Historically, Silicon Valley functioned as a relatively uniform ecosystem where similar companies (e.g., SaaS, consumer apps) followed similar paths. The "Archipelago" theory suggests this is over. Value is now created in isolated clusters rather than one central hub. Final Recommendations If your search for "the archipelago

  • Islands of Transformation: The economy is breaking into distinct "islands." These are specific industries or domains undergoing radical change (e.g., Climate Tech, Crypto/Web3, Defense, Biotech/Longevity). Each island has its own rules, culture, and capital requirements.

  • Inflection Points: Startups can no longer just be "better" versions of existing companies. To succeed on an island, they must capitalize on specific inflection points—technological shifts (like AI) or social shifts—that create new openings.

  • Thematic vs. Geographical: Investors and founders are no longer defined by where they are (San Francisco/New York) but by which "island" they inhabit. A founder in Climate Tech has more in common with a climate founder in a different country than with a Web3 founder in the same city.

  • The Role of the "Crazy" Founder: The conversation often highlights that the best founders are "misfits" who see the future of their specific island clearly, while the mainstream market (the "continent") views them as crazy until the island becomes too big to ignore.
